School Information

St Martin's Ampleforth is a prep, pre-prep and nursery school for children aged 3-13, taking day and boarding pupils. We are a Benedictine school, affiliated to Ampleforth College, based in Gilling Castle and its surrounding 2000 acres. Facilities include a large sports hall, a nine hole golf course, a full sized astroturf, playing fields and a dedicated music and performing arts building.
